From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.44 [gcide]:

Darlingtonia \Dar'ling*to"ni*a\, noun [NL. Named after Dr. William Darlington, a botanist of West Chester, Penn.] (Bot.) A genus of California pitcher plants consisting of a single species. The long tubular leaves are hooded at the top, and frequently contain many insects drowned in the secretion of the leaves.
